Output 6cbbef63ae3e0e59f15d37d4c0c99266d75cfc9cd52a290f7ce6795d9399f8e6:0

value
73585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595b49ad6cbfa832c7a0a037996ecebd026475c5 OP_EQUAL
address
39qVRQQaBYk6DXn5YPEfZCzPE9hnuKuN1e
transaction
6cbbef63ae3e0e59f15d37d4c0c99266d75cfc9cd52a290f7ce6795d9399f8e6
spent
true